Kumi Koda / “Fate” (from the new album “WINTER of LOVE”)
fateKōda Kumi

You want to connect with someone you care about, but you can’t… That poignant backstory comes through in this song.

It’s a track by Kumi Koda, the diva who led the Japanese music scene in the 2000s, released in 2006 as her 34th single.

It was chosen as the theme song for the film “Ōoku,” attracting a lot of attention.

The grand arrangement built around the sound of the piano matches the message of the lyrics.

It’s a song that really hits you in the heart and can genuinely make you cry—highly recommended for karaoke, too.

“the meaning of peace” was released in 2001 as a single duet by Kumi Koda and BoA.

With the Japan–Korea World Cup approaching the following year in 2002, it also conveyed an intention to foster a mood of goodwill between the two countries.

A song by female singer Kumi Koda—praised for her powerful vocals and emotional resonance—and the dance & vocal group EXILE, who have secured unwavering popularity with their unrivaled high-level performances.

Since the original number was released by the Bubblegum Brothers in 1990 and became a major hit, it’s widely recognized across generations and always livens up karaoke.

Beyond its catchy melody, the off-beat rhythm is the key to this track, making it a duet song where you’ll want to lean into the groove when singing it at karaoke.
